Top Gear
So Top Gear returned last night - and I have to say it was a lot better without Chris Evans shoutiness. I'm still not sold 100% on Matt Le Blanc but on the whole it was an enjoyable watch. They've gone back to the original circuit for the celebrity laps - and changed the car to a Toyota GT86 which should make things interesting!
One episode of the Evans Top Gear was enough for me - I just couldn't put up with him. On the basis of last nights episode I'm hopeful for the rest of the series - they're not Clarkson, Hammond and May - but they are watchable and it's got to be better than 95% of the other stuff that's on! |
